£364 might seem reasonable to some,but it’s a big hike from what we are paying now.We have full no claims,no points ,over 65 and live in the North Wales countryside.I have a z4 which is £160 to insure fully comp.
A lot of people forget that their old car is worth (say) £15-20k, and the new one is insured for £33k or whatever...so double the potential pay-out for insurers
